    The L in the G055LANV35 stands for “length” as in a longer blade than their regular 555 counterparts. I’m a Grizzly employee and I work on these kind of machines everyday. If you’re interested in the 555 series, might I suggest the G0555XH (xtra height). Those seem to be the best of the 555 series.

    I glad you had a good result with that blade. It sounds like a good design. But I have had a BAD experience with laguna and that blade. I bought one 155" blade and the weld was so bad that the blade almost jumped out of the support bearings. They quickly sent me a replacement and it was just as bad. And after that they quick answering my emails. I took the blade to a local saw shop and they could not fix the problem. I decided I'm too old to be wasting my time getting this corrected. I am taking the loss. I also have a Hitachi resaw bandsaw with a 3" wide blade that tracks well. My local equipment shop was also sending back a poorly welded resaw king blade. So just be careful dealing with laguna.

    I've got the same Laguna saw and Resaw King blade and I 100% agree that they are fabulous! My only criticism of the machine is that the outfeed side of the fence tends to deflect to the left if I apply a little too much lateral pressure to keep the piece in contact with the fence through the cut. Have you run into this and/or come up with any solutions?

    • @JayBates2
      @JayBates2  ปีที่แล้ว +4

      That's the worst thing about the saw. However, the fence is shaped perfectly to accept an F style clamp right in the back to clamp it to the table.

    i couldn't avoid noticing that the teeth on that sawblade have irregular spacing. is that intentional?

    • @JayBates2
      @JayBates2  ปีที่แล้ว

      Yes. Not sure why. But it is.

    • @ezraherman1413
      @ezraherman1413 10 หลายเดือนก่อน

      Yes it is. Called 'variable spacing', i think. It is to dampen resonant vibration and make the cut smoother. It's the same reason you have irregular spacing on high quality rasps and why troops don't march in step across bridges...
